Transaction 27dc391ea02809cf4fe506f09f944dff41cbd3015ca95b73e7ff1490b092868b

1 Input
2 Outputs
  • 27dc391ea02809cf4fe506f09f944dff41cbd3015ca95b73e7ff1490b092868b:0
  • value  3684698
    address  3GEW93szW39ZUnpYhiizosLSyUcjyquogL
  • 27dc391ea02809cf4fe506f09f944dff41cbd3015ca95b73e7ff1490b092868b:1
  • value  1805526
    address  3DUvFVXk69sJM4P21dnSsQVKEVPzkuyGys